ESMT ESMT Berlin is the highest-ranked business school in Germany and Top 10 in Europe. Founded by 25 leading global companies, ESMT offers master’s, MBA, and PhD programs, as well as executive education on its campus in Berlin, in locations around the world, online, and in online blended format. Focusing on leadership, innovation, and analytics, its diverse faculty publishes outstanding research in top academic journals. View School Profile

AMBS At Alliance Manchester Business School, ‘Original Thinking Applied’ sits at the heart of everything we do. Drawing on Manchester’s rich history, we aspire to deliver inventive business and management solutions through our world-class research and teaching. Established in 1965 as one of the UK’s first two business schools, we are proud to be part of the prestigious University of Manchester and the UK’s largest campus-based business and management school. Top 10 Executive Courses in Agribusiness

Global shifts from climate change, environmental pressures to geopolitical tensions are reshaping the business of agriculture. Executives are having to manage supply chain risks and even find opportunities arising from international changes to the economic, political and social landscape.

Some will find value in an executive education course at a business school. Many top institutions are teaching courses tailored to the agribusiness industry, which cover the major trends in the sector and help participants to build competitive advantage and drive business growth.

Often these courses are delivered in partnership with multiple schools and industry associations, helping to blend theory and practice and expand the network for participants who are leading food producers from across the world. The programs feature extensive networking with food industry executives, in addition to a curriculum of study covering strategic marketing, executive presence, communication and much more.

Top 10 Executive Courses in Cybersecurity and Digital Risks

Cybersecurity is no longer the domain of the IT department: it is a topic that is gaining importance in the business world. It is a critical part of nearly every aspect of business decision-making, from due diligence in mergers and acquisitions to supply chain security and enterprise risk management. Therefore, managers who understand the growing cyber threat to their organizations, and what they can do to mitigate, the risk have a competitive advantage.

Several business schools are now offering executive courses that give senior managers the skills in cybersecurity risk management they need to better protect their organizations. As the cost of breaches soars, building cyber resilience is an urgent priority for leaders in business and the number of programs, while limited for now, is expected to grow in line with cyber as a board-level issue.

Top 10 Executive Courses for Chief Financial Officers

The role of the chief financial officer (CFO) is being transformed by a confluence of factors, from changing operating models to digitalization and society’s changing expectations. CFOs are now expected to become strategic partners to their CEOs, with a seat at the table for developing overall corporate strategy.

This means that the skills and competencies that the modern CFOs need to succeed is changing. Happily, a number of executive education programs have stepped in to help facilitate the role’s transformation.

These courses help participants to strengthen their leadership capabilities and learn how to communicate financial input more effectively, while also gaining insight into the latest developments in corporate finance.

Digital technology is a prominent theme for many of these courses, as CFOs use data analytics to build the finance function of the future. Another major development that is changing the CFO role is the growing importance of ESG (environmental, social and governance) factors in financial reporting.

All of this and more is covered in the courses listed below. Ultimately, CFOs taking these programs will gain the skills and confidence to lead their organizations and drive growth.

Top 10 Executive Courses in Negotiation

Little in business or life gets done without a negotiation, so executive education programs that deal with mediation have the potential to deliver significant value for your professional and personal life. 

In executive courses in negotiation, participants, who come from broad array of backgrounds, learn foundational skills for managing complex and multinational negotiations in different cultures and regions — such as how to prepare, lead and adapt negotiations. This includes effective communication and coalition building, as well as leveraging social capital to negotiate successfully. 

Executive courses in negotiation also delve into the social psychology of negotiation, in terms of how to influence people and gain stakeholder buy-in. 

These hands-on programs enable participants to experiment with new techniques and test their negotiation effectiveness in the safety of the classroom. Through role plays and simulations of real-life business scenarios, led by expert faculty, participants learn to manage conflict and build trust, how to find alignment and achieve successful deals. 

In some cases, participants will be involved in hands-on activities, such as predicting their counterpart’s behavior, and dealing with “dirty tactics”.  

Through feedback from classmates, they take an objective look at their negotiation style. In some executive negotiation programs, they receive individual executive coaching to help develop their own personal style and play to their strengths. In doing so, they gain greater confidence, and develop a systematic approach for a variety of situations. 

They leave with a robust framework for negotiations, whether they’re online or in person, and learn how to align their strategy with strategic business objectives. Ultimately, participants learn how to create value for their organizations, make better decisions and deliver hard results.

Top 10 Executive Courses in Healthcare

The coronavirus pandemic has exposed the pressures on health systems across the globe, requiring innovative solutions to manage and improve the delivery of care. A number of business schools thus report a rise in demand for their executive education programs that target the healthcare sector. 

Some of the best executive courses in healthcare are delivered through partnerships run by schools across multiple continents, giving students a global perspective and opportunities for even more extensive networking. Some of the courses are delivered jointly with healthcare organizations, which ensures that the curriculum remains responsive to industry demands so that alumni can hit the ground running in their leadership roles. 

The programs offer an interactive learning experience, with participants often working on their own real healthcare issues as part of their course. Many of the programs focus on innovation and digitization in the healthcare sector, and may even cover subjects such as design thinking.

The programs are wide-ranging in their length, spanning a few days to a couple of years, but all are delivered part-time and most offer a hybrid experience, blending in person teaching with remote study. 

For the best healthcare executive programs, the admissions process may be highly selective and the programs draw senior executives and policymakers, though some courses are specifically aimed at nurturing the next generation of healthcare leaders and target doctors who are just starting to amass management responsibilities. 

Top 10 Executive Courses in AI and Machine Learning

Artificial intelligence (AI) is transforming business and life more broadly. Referring to the development of computer systems that can perform tasks that once required human intelligence, AI is being applied to a number of business settings to create new economic value. 

In a data-driven world, executives need a thorough understanding of the power of AI to boost their individual and organizational performance, as well as its ethical implications for wider society and the threats it represents. Indeed, by 2025 the global AI market is expected to be worth almost $60 billion. 

To compete in a tech-driven economy, many business leaders, managers and technical specialists are enrolling in executive education programs—in artificial intelligence or machine learning—now run by dozens of the world’s leading business schools. In these programs, participants will learn about the current capabilities and business applications of the technology, and its future potential. More than that, executives will learn how to manage integration projects and communicate with technologists. There are also lessons to be learnt in avoiding common pitfalls.

Top 10 Executive Courses for Social Entrepreneurs and Nonprofit Leaders

Social entrepreneurship and nonprofit organizations are part of a rapidly growing movement that seeks to create societal value and protect the environment alongside generating economic value. A number of business schools offer excellent executive education programs for managers who operate in this dynamic and rewarding space. 

The programs typically offer a flexible schedule, practical application of classroom learning in the workplace and a sophisticated curriculum offering a strong foundation in nonprofit management and leadership. The executive courses help mission-driven leaders develop their strategy, financial and fundraising skills. Participants also learn a great deal from one another. 

The programs will either be either for social enraptures or nonprofit leaders. Participants who are social entrepreneurs will develop entrepreneurial skills, learning how to integrate design thinking and social innovation, in addition to measuring the impact of their social venture model.  The nonprofit executive courses focus on strengthening people’s leadership capabilities and encouraging them to spark innovation and lead change within their organizations. 

Top 10 Executive Courses on Women Leadership

There is a big push for more women on listed company boards in many countries around the world, with governments encouraging more women through the ranks into executive positions to boost the “pipeline” of potential board candidates.

Diversity at the top can improve companies’ profitability. However, there remains much more to do to improve gender balance in the boardroom. Women still face a number of specific challenges in the workplace. And business schools have created a bevy of leadership courses designed to address the varied issues faced by women in business. The programs offer training in communication skills, authentic leadership, and leadership progression.

Participants gain the skills to advance their professional careers and the careers of other female executives as well as lead larger teams, with many of the courses also placing a heavy emphasis on the idea of purpose. The executives learn how to build a better corporate culture and sustain momentum towards positive change.

Top 10 Executive Courses in Strategy or Strategic Management

Companies today are having to respond to rapid changes in business and society amid increasing competitive threats but also business opportunities for companies bold enough to shape their market. 

Happily, there are a wide range of executive education courses in strategy or strategic management offered by some of the world’s leading business schools around the world. On these courses, participants learn how to assess threats and opportunities, and build a compelling vision for transformation based on the broader environmental, political and social landscape. 

In these strategy-oriented executive courses, participants discover how to choose the right team members and nurture the best ideas, putting together a strategic plan of action. Then, the executives enrolled in these 10 leading programs learn how to build innovation capability and lead change management. They come away with the confidence to take on tough challenges and develop solutions that drive organizational performance. 

The best executive courses in strategy cover a wide range of topics that are important for managers with increasing responsibility.
